Adventure Time: Pirates of the Enchiridion Coming to Switch, PS4, Xbox One, PC in Spring 2018

 Outright Games has announced Adventure Time: Pirates of the Enchiridion for the PlayStation 4, Xbox One, Nintendo Switch, and Windows PC. It will launch in spring 2018. 


Here is an overview of the game:

In this brand-new, hilarious Adventure Time story, gamers play as Finn, Jake, Marceline, and BMO to explore fan-favorite kingdoms, and meet the well-loved characters from Cartoon Network’s popular TV animation series.

The game starts with a flooded Land of Ooo, in which familiar kingdoms are cut off from each other by rising waters. In their newly constructed boat (hold that thought*) Finn and Jake set sail to investigate what the junk went down.

During their adventures Finn and Jake will recruit friends to join their crew, jump into swashbuckling fights, interrogate characters for clues, and traverse the new and dangerous sea to locations across Ooo.

Key Features:

  • Open-world exploration
  • 3D visuals that match the art-style of the show
  • Playable fan-favorite characters: Finn, Jake, BMO, and Marceline
  • An original Adventure Time story
  • Tactical combat
  • Hero progression
  • Pirates – “Shiver me timbers!”
